KFC Whipped Potatoes

900 g coliban potatoes, about 8 medium

½ cup milk

¼ cup butter

1/8 tsp fresh ground black pepper

1 tsp salt

1

Peel potatoes and quarter. Place in a medium saucepan; add water and a few teaspoons of salt. Bring to a boil; cover and cook for 15 to 20 minutes, until tender. Drain well.

2

Beat potatoes in saucepan over low heat with electric hand-held mixer on low speed until broken up. Heat milk and butter together. Pour hot milk and butter over hot potatoes and beat on high speed until fluffy, scraping sides and bottom of pan occasionally. Season with salt and pepper.

Tips

* Tip if it starts to boil over drop in a couple of ice cubes and turn the flame down a little. You can also prevent boiling over by adding a tablespoon of oil.

** Also add the milk and butter a little at a time. If it's too runny you can't fix it unless you add in some instant mashed potatoes.
